#074664 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#074664 is composed of 2.7% red, 27.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 199.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 21%. #074664 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e8cc8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#074664 color description : Very dark blue.
#074664 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#074664 has RGB values of R:7, G:70,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 476772.

Shades and Tints of #074664
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#074664
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343637 is the less saturated color, while #034768 is the most saturated one.
